I'm Faiza Shah MNCPS, a British-qualified therapist dedicated to helping people navigate anxiety, trauma, grief, burnout and life transitions with compassion and evidence-based care.

My qualifications in Counselling & Therapy and Human Physiology allow me to understand the powerful connection between emotional wellbeing and physical health, providing a truly holistic therapeutic approach.

As a Psychosomatic Mind–Body Therapist, I help clients recognise how unresolved emotions can influence the body, while my Trauma & Grief Informed practice creates a safe and supportive environment for healing.

Whether you're facing a difficult life transition, experiencing overwhelming emotions, or simply looking for a space where you can feel heard, I am committed to supporting your journey with empathy, professionalism and genuine care.
